Second Suspect Arrested in Germany's Nord Stream Case
Croatian police arrested a second suspect in Pula, Croatia. The arrest came under a European warrant from Germany.
German prosecutors say he is a Ukrainian trained scuba diver. They suspect he helped cause explosions on the Nord Stream pipelines.
He is expected to be sent to Germany for trial. He will appear before a federal court judge there.
Prosecutors say he was part of a group. That group planted explosives on Nord Stream 1 and Nord Stream 2. This happened near Denmark's Bornholm island in September 2022.
